Job Overview We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ented CNC Set Up Operator specializing in Mill and Lathes to join our dynamic manufacturing team. In this role, you will be responsible for setting up, programming, and operating CNC milling machines and lathes to produce precision metal components. Your expertise will ensure efficient production processes, high-quality output, and adherence to safety standards. Responsibilities Prepare and set up CNC milling machines and lathes, including installing tooling, fixtures, and workpieces according to blueprints and specifications Interpret mechanical blueprints, technical drawings, and G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ing) to ensure accurate machining processes Perform precision measurements using calipers, micrometers, bore gauges, dial indicators, and other measurement tools to verify part dimensions during setup and production Conduct quality inspections of machined parts through CNC quality inspection techniques to maintain strict tolerances Adjust machine parameters as needed for optimal performance and troubleshoot machining issues promptly Maintain a clean and organized work area while adhering to all safety protocols related to machine operation and tooling Qualifications Proven experience operating CNC mills and lathes with a strong understanding of machine setup, calibration, and troubleshooting Proficiency in CNC programming languages Solid knowledge of blueprint reading, mechanical blueprint interpretation, GD&T principles, and measurement techniques Familiarity with CAM programming software such as Mastercam or SolidWorks is highly desirable Mechanical knowledge related to machining tools, grinders, hand tools, power tools, tooling setups, and assembly processes Ability to perform basic math calculations necessary for precision machining tasks Experience with manual machining operations is a plus but not required Strong attention to detail with excellent measurement skills using calipers, micrometers, bore gauges, and other precision instruments Commitment to safety standards in a manufacturing environment Join our team as a CNC Set Up Operator Mill & Lathes to contribute your skills in a fast-paced manufacturing setting where quality meets efficiency.
